18ct two-tone gold, ruby and diamond ring, circa 1940; of retro design, the top channel set with carre-cut rubies and brilliant-cut diamonds, opening to reveal a hidden compartment, the rubies together weighing approximately 0.25 carats, the diamonds together weighing approximately 0.17 carats, size N-O.

  • Circa - A Latin term meaning 'about', often used in the antique trade to give an approximate date for the piece, usually considered to be five years on either side of the circa year. Thus, circa 1900 means the piece was made about 1900, probably between 1895 and 1905. The expression is sometimes abbreviated to c.1900.
